The relationship between sodium and blood pressure is well-documented, with reduction often leading to measurable improvements in cardiovascular health. Current Daily Recommendations Health authorities generally agree that adults should limit sodium to 2,300 milligrams per day, equivalent to about one teaspoon of salt.
